SEO Starts With Demand, Not Content

A common mistake across industries is:

Creating content first, then trying to optimize it for SEO.


In reality, effective SEO starts with:

  • What users are searching

  • How frequently they search

  • How competitive those topics are


Using Ubersuggest, product marketers can:

  • Identify high-demand keywords

  • Understand search volume

  • Evaluate competition levels


SEO improves when content is demand-driven, not assumption-driven.

Align Content With Search Intent

A key challenge across industries:

Mismatch between content and user intent.


Users may search to:

  • Learn

  • Compare

  • Decide


Using Ubersuggest, teams can:

  • Understand keyword intent

  • Analyze top-ranking content

  • Align content format with expectations


This ensures that content is relevant, not just optimized.
